Press Release Summary: Gunshot Act 2017 – Medical Facilities Must Comply



The Federal Ministry of Health and Social Welfare has raised concern over increasing deaths caused by hospitals refusing to treat gunshot victims without a police report. This violates the Gunshot Act 2017, which mandates that all hospitals—public or private—must treat gunshot victims immediately, with or without police clearance.


Key points:


Hospitals must treat gunshot victims as emergencies.


Police reports are not required before treatment.


Security agents and individuals must assist in getting victims to hospitals.


The Ministry is implementing strategies to ensure compliance.


The police are urged to support enforcement and reassure hospitals that providing such treatment is legal.



Healthcare providers are reminded: saving lives comes first.
